ArtsFest aims to engage our campus and greater regional community with international artists, art, and artmaking opportunities that reach across disciplines, subject matter, and boundaries, with the intention of fostering relationships, connections, and ideas that affect positive change in our world. Now in its fourth year, ArtsFest is a unique event to Franklin County and the surrounding communities which highlights the outstanding arts and artists in our community. This year’s theme is ART IS... EXPERIMENTATION. 

We are seeking Chambersburg and surrounding area artists and arts educators (visual, performing, and literary) who are interested in sharing their experience, expertise, and work at ArtsFest 2026. Appropriate events can be in the form of a presentation/reading, performance, project, workshop/class, exhibition, immersive experience, or other type of arts-based event.  

Interested parties should complete the proposal form AVAILABLE HERE by November 8. All ideas are welcome, and the committee is happy to work with anyone who has an idea but needs assistance in bringing it to fruition. Proposals should be financially self-supported, though funding may be available on a very limited case-by-case basis.
